5步掌握全功能开源项目管理工具OpenProject,高效协作从这里开始
在当今快节奏的团队协作环境中,选择一款合适的项目管理工具至关重要。作为领先的开源项目管理工具,OpenProject为团队提供了完整的项目规划、任务跟踪和协作解决方案,帮助团队轻松应对各种复杂项目挑战。无论是初创团队还是大型企业,这款免费工具都能满足你的项目管理需求,让团队协作更高效、项目交付更准时。
零基础上手开源项目管理工具:核心价值与优势
OpenProject作为一款全功能的开源项目管理工具,其核心价值在于提供了一个集成化的协作平台,让团队成员能够在同一环境中完成项目规划、任务分配、进度跟踪和文档管理等工作。与其他项目管理工具相比,OpenProject具有以下显著优势:
- 开源免费:社区版完全免费,源代码开放,可根据团队需求进行定制化开发
- 功能全面:支持瀑布模型、敏捷开发等多种项目管理方法,满足不同团队的工作方式
- 灵活部署:可在本地服务器、私有云或公共云上部署,确保数据安全和隐私保护
- 强大集成:支持与Git、SVN等版本控制系统,以及各种第三方工具集成
- 多语言支持:提供多种语言界面,方便全球团队使用
项目管理场景实战:从任务创建到进度跟踪
工作包管理:项目任务的核心载体
工作包是OpenProject中最基本的任务单元,它可以是一个任务、一个功能点、一个bug或者一个里程碑。通过工作包,团队可以清晰地定义任务内容、负责人、截止日期等关键信息。
工作包功能解决什么问题:传统的任务管理方式往往分散在不同的工具中,导致信息不集中、跟踪困难。OpenProject的工作包功能将所有任务信息集中管理,让团队成员随时了解任务状态和进度。
带来什么价值:提高任务透明度,减少沟通成本,确保团队成员明确自己的工作职责和时间节点,从而提高整体工作效率。
甘特图规划:可视化项目进度
甘特图是项目管理中常用的可视化工具,它可以直观地展示项目中各个任务的时间安排和依赖关系。OpenProject提供了强大的甘特图功能,帮助项目经理更好地规划和调整项目进度。
甘特图功能解决什么问题:在复杂项目中,任务之间的依赖关系往往很复杂,手动跟踪容易出错。甘特图功能可以清晰地展示任务之间的依赖关系,帮助项目经理发现潜在的进度风险。
带来什么价值:通过可视化的方式展示项目进度,让团队成员和 stakeholders 能够快速了解项目状态,及时调整工作计划,确保项目按时交付。
跨团队协作场景:打破部门壁垒,实现高效协同
在现代企业中,项目往往需要多个部门的协作完成。OpenProject提供了丰富的功能,支持跨部门、跨团队的高效协作。
团队成员管理:明确角色与权限
OpenProject允许项目经理为不同的团队成员分配不同的角色和权限,确保每个人只能访问和操作自己权限范围内的内容。
成员管理功能解决什么问题:在大型项目中,团队成员众多,权限管理复杂。不当的权限设置可能导致敏感信息泄露或误操作。
带来什么价值:通过精细化的权限管理,确保项目数据的安全性和完整性,同时让团队成员能够专注于自己的工作内容,提高工作效率。
自动化工作流:减少重复工作,提高协作效率
OpenProject的自动化工作流功能可以根据预设的规则自动执行一些重复性的工作,如任务状态更新、通知发送等。
自动化工作流功能解决什么问题:在项目管理过程中,有很多重复性的工作需要手动完成,不仅浪费时间,还容易出错。
带来什么价值:通过自动化工作流,减少手动操作,提高工作效率,同时确保工作流程的一致性和规范性。
3种部署方案对比:选择最适合你的方式
| 部署方案 | 难度 | 成本 | 维护 | 适用场景 |
|---|---|---|---|---|
| Docker部署 | 低 | 中 | 中 | 快速试用、小型团队 |
| 系统包管理器安装 | 中 | 低 | 高 | 本地服务器部署、有IT团队支持 |
| 源码编译安装 | 高 | 低 | 高 | 定制化需求高、技术实力强的团队 |
Docker部署:这是最简单的部署方式,只需执行以下命令即可快速启动OpenProject:
git clone https://gitcode.com/GitHub_Trending/op/openproject
cd openproject
docker-compose up -d
新手常见误区解析
误区一:过度定制化工作流
很多新手在使用OpenProject时,会尝试将工作流定制得非常复杂,以满足各种可能的场景。然而,过度复杂的工作流反而会降低团队的工作效率。
正确做法:从简单的工作流开始,随着项目的进展和团队的熟悉程度,逐步优化和调整工作流。
误区二:忽视权限管理
有些团队在使用OpenProject时,为了方便,给所有成员都分配了较高的权限,这可能导致敏感信息泄露或误操作。
正确做法:根据团队成员的角色和职责,合理分配权限,确保每个成员只能访问和操作自己工作所需的内容。
误区三:不重视项目模板
很多团队在创建新项目时,总是从零开始配置,没有充分利用OpenProject提供的项目模板功能。
正确做法:根据项目类型,选择合适的项目模板,或者创建自己的项目模板,以提高项目创建效率。
进阶技巧:让OpenProject发挥最大价值
利用项目模板快速启动项目
OpenProject提供了多种项目模板,如软件开发、产品发布、市场营销等。你也可以创建自己的项目模板,将常用的任务结构、工作流等保存下来,以便在创建新项目时快速应用。
集成第三方工具扩展功能
OpenProject支持与多种第三方工具集成,如GitLab、GitHub、Slack等。通过集成这些工具,可以将代码管理、沟通协作等功能无缝整合到OpenProject中,提高团队的工作效率。
定期生成项目报告
OpenProject提供了丰富的报表功能,可以生成项目进度、任务完成情况、工时统计等多种报表。定期生成这些报表,可以帮助项目经理及时了解项目状态,发现问题并采取措施。
总结:选择合适的项目管理工具,开启高效协作之旅
OpenProject作为一款全功能的开源项目管理工具,适用于各种规模和类型的团队。无论是软件开发、市场营销还是企业内部项目管理,OpenProject都能提供强大的支持。
现在就行动起来,尝试使用OpenProject来管理你的下一个项目。相信它会成为你团队协作的得力助手,帮助你实现高效的项目管理。
随着远程协作和敏捷开发的普及,开源项目管理工具将在团队协作中发挥越来越重要的作用。选择一款适合自己团队的项目管理工具,将是提升团队效率、实现项目成功的关键一步。
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
atomcodeAn open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ust030
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
HY-Embodied-0.5这是一套专为现实世界具身智能打造的基础模型。该系列模型采用创新的混合Transformer(Mixture-of-Transformers, MoT) 架构,通过潜在令牌实现模态特异性计算,显著提升了细粒度感知能力。Jinja00
ERNIE-ImageERNIE-Image 是由百度 ERNIE-Image 团队开发的开源文本到图像生成模型。它基于单流扩散 Transformer(DiT)构建,并配备了轻量级的提示增强器,可将用户的简短输入扩展为更丰富的结构化描述。凭借仅 80 亿的 DiT 参数,它在开源文本到图像模型中达到了最先进的性能。该模型的设计不仅追求强大的视觉质量,还注重实际生成场景中的可控性,在这些场景中,准确的内容呈现与美观同等重要。特别是,ERNIE-Image 在复杂指令遵循、文本渲染和结构化图像生成方面表现出色,使其非常适合商业海报、漫画、多格布局以及其他需要兼具视觉质量和精确控制的内容创作任务。它还支持广泛的视觉风格,包括写实摄影、设计导向图像以及更多风格化的美学输出。Jinja00



